Abstract:
A highly thermally conductive but yet highly conformable composition is made from gel filled with alumina. The use of .alpha.-alumina in which at least 10 weight % of the .alpha.-alumina particles have a particle size of at least 74 .mu.m makes possible the high filler levels needed to attain high thermal conductivity, without causing the decrease in elongation and softness normally associated with high filler levels. Further improvements are observed if the .alpha.-alumina and the gel (or precursor thereof) are mixed with a specific energy input of at least 10 Joule/g. The input of such specific energy has the effect making the resulting composition more conformable than it otherwise would be. The composition may be internally supported by a flexible matrix such as a fabric or open-celled foam.
